What is an independent contractor meat butcher?

Independent Contractor Meat Butchers are skilled professionals who process, cut, and prepare meat for sale or further processing, working on a contract basis rather than as direct employees. They may provide their services to supermarkets, restaurants, or meat processing facilities, often bringing their own tools and equipment. These butchers are responsible for ensuring meat quality, adhering to safety and sanitation regulations, and sometimes sourcing their own clients. Their independence allows them greater flexibility in choosing assignments and setting rates, but also means they handle their own business operations, such as taxes and insurance.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as an independent contractor meat butcher?

To thrive as an Independent Contractor Meat Butcher, you need expertise in meat cutting, knowledge of animal anatomy, and adherence to food safety standards, usually gained through formal training or apprenticeship. Familiarity with specialized butchery tools, meat processing equipment, and compliance with HACCP or local food safety certifications are essential. Strong attention to detail, time management, and customer service skills help set you apart in this role. These skills ensure high-quality products, safety, and customer satisfaction, which are critical for maintaining reputation and business growth.

What are common challenges faced by independent contractor meat butchers, and how can they be addressed?

Independent contractor meat butchers often face challenges such as managing fluctuating workloads, ensuring consistent product quality, and handling the business aspects of their work, including client acquisition and billing. Since they are not tied to a single employer, building strong relationships with clients and maintaining a reliable schedule can be demanding. Staying up-to-date with food safety regulations and investing in quality tools also requires ongoing attention. Networking within the industry and adopting efficient time management practices can help overcome these challenges and support business growth.

What is the difference between Independent Contractor Meat Butcher vs Employee Meat Butcher?

AspectIndependent Contractor Meat ButcherEmployee Meat Butcher
CredentialsMay require certifications in meat cutting and safetyTypically requires similar certifications, often provided by employer
Work EnvironmentSelf-employed, flexible hours, works at various locationsEmployed by a specific employer, fixed hours, in a retail or processing facility
Employer & Industry UsageWorks independently, contracts with butchery businesses or marketsHired directly by a butcher shop or meat processing plant
Search & Comparison IntentOften searched for by those seeking freelance or flexible work optionsCommonly searched by those looking for traditional employment

In summary, an Independent Contractor Meat Butcher operates independently, often with flexible hours and multiple clients, while an Employee Meat Butcher works directly for a single employer with set hours. Both roles require similar certifications and skills, but differ mainly in work arrangement and employment status.
